[Detailed Description of the Invention] [Field of Industrial Application] The present invention relates to a safety device for a portable gas stove using a small detachable gas cylinder.

When using a portable gas stove, first press the set lever to press the nozzle at the end of the gas cylinder to the insertion opening of the gas appliance tap, then open the gas path with the appliance tap knob to introduce gas to the burner and ignite it. When extinguishing a fire, there is no problem if you turn the appliance valve knob to block the gas path, but often the appliance valve knob is left in the open position and only the set lever is operated to cut off the gas and extinguish the fire. In the case of this type of fire extinguishing method, when the gas cylinder is set with the set lever at the time of relighting, the appliance stopper remains in the open position and raw gas is injected from the burner, which is extremely dangerous and can cause various accidents. In view of the above drawbacks, the present invention improves safety by locking the appliance stopper knob before setting the set lever, and locking the set lever when turning the appliance stopper knob to the open position after setting the set lever. be.

Next, embodiments of the present invention will be described with reference to the drawings.
FIG. 2 is a plan view using the device of the present invention, and 1 is a stove body, which is equipped with a combustion chamber 3 equipped with a burner 2 and a cylinder chamber 5 into which a gas cylinder 4 is detachably installed. An instrument stopper 6 equipped with a safety valve that senses abnormal pressure and shuts off the gas path is attached to one end of the cylinder chamber 5, and by pressing down the set lever 7, the tip nozzle of the gas cylinder 4 is pressed into the insertion opening of the instrument stopper 6. A cylinder pressing mechanism 8 is provided. Reference numeral 9 denotes an instrument stopper knob attached to the instrument stopper shaft 10 to open and close the gas passage. Reference numeral 11 denotes a sliding plate, which is slidably mounted on the mounting board 12 and interlocked with the instrument stopper shaft 10. The sliding plate 11 has a square-shaped step formed at its left end, and has a vertical hole 1 bored at the left end of the mounting board 12.
3, and when the device stopper shaft 10 is fully opened, it is moved to the left so that the left end of the sliding plate 11 overlaps the hole 13.
The set lever 7, which is vertically movably inserted into the set lever 7, is locked to prevent it from rising. When the instrument stopper shaft 10 is fully rotated, the sliding plate 11 is moved to the right and moved away from the hole 13, and the set lever 7 is unlocked. When the set lever 7 is pushed up in this state, the sliding plate 11 is further pushed and slid to the right, and is moved to a position where the safety valve 15 of the appliance stopper 6 is pressed. The safety valve 15 does not protrude from the appliance stopper 6 during normal combustion, but when the gas pressure rises abnormally as described above, the safety valve 15 operates and protrudes from the appliance stopper 6 and prevents gas from the gas cylinder 4. The circuit is closed to prevent gas from entering the appliance tap 6, and if gas cannot be supplied regardless of whether the appliance tap 6 is opened, it is necessary to press the safety valve 15 to reconnect the gas path. Thus, when the gas cylinder 4 is removed from the appliance stopper 6 by pushing up the set lever 15, the sliding plate 11 is simultaneously moved to open the safety valve 15.

Next, I will discuss the effect of this proposal. First, the gas cylinder 4 is placed in the cylinder chamber 5, and the set lever 7 is pushed down to press the tip nozzle of the gas cylinder 4 into contact with the insertion opening of the instrument stopper 6. Next, when the instrument stopper shaft 10 is rotated to open the stopper, the sliding plate 11 is interlocked, slides to the left, overlaps the slot 13, and locks the set lever 7 to prevent it from rising. (See Figure 4 A) In this way, the gas in the gas cylinder 4 is supplied to the appliance plug 6.
is supplied to the burner.

An appropriate amount of play is provided in the interlocking mechanism between the appliance plug shaft 10 and the sliding plate 11, so that after the set lever 7 is locked, the appliance plug shaft 10 is independently rotated slightly in the closing direction, and the combustion flame is released. In order to prevent the sliding plate 11 from moving inadvertently during this period, the sliding plate 11 is pressed to the left by a pressing spring 14. In this case, the set lever 7 is
Since it is always locked, the set lever 7 cannot be operated while the instrument stopper shaft 10 remains in the open position.

Next, when extinguishing a fire, when the appliance stopper shaft 10 is rotated to the fully closed position, the sliding plate 11 is also interlocked and slid to the right to unblock the hole 13, as shown in Figure 4 (b). Move to position. (In this case, the gas cylinder remains set.) To relight the gas in this state, it is only necessary to rotate the appliance stopper shaft 10 again.

Next, to release the set of gas cylinders 4, push up the set lever 7, and the cylinder pressing mechanism 8 will move the gas cylinders 4 away from the appliance stopper 6, and at the same time, the upper end of the set lever 7 will be pressed against the inclined surface 16 of the left edge of the sliding plate 11. Since the edges rise while slidingly contacting each other, the sliding plate 11 is pushed to the right against the elastic force of the push spring 14 and prevents the instrument stopper shaft 10 from rotating to open the stopper. (See Figure 4 C.) [Effect of the invention] The present invention prevents the rotation of the instrument stopper shaft 10 with the set lever 7 before the set lever 7 is set, and sets the instrument stopper knob 9 to the open position after the set lever 7 is set. Since the set lever 7 is locked by the sliding plate 11 when the device is rotated to the position shown in FIG. By making it impossible to extinguish only the set lever 7 due to incorrect operation when extinguishing a fire, it is possible to prevent the disadvantage of raw gas spouting out by setting the gas cylinder 4 with the appliance tap 6 in the open position, and it does not require any extra parts. There is also an effect that the structure can be constructed by only partially changing the shape of the conventional sliding plate without having to do so.
